mortgage: What You Need to Know About Adjustable-Rate Mortgage - 07/01/22 08:38 PM
Adjustable-rate mortgage (ARM), also known as variable-rate mortgages, is a home loan with a fixed initial interest rate that varies periodically, meaning that monthly payments may fluctuate based on changes in a financial index. ARMs are suitable for various homebuyers, including growing families, homeowners in short-term housing situations, and borrowers who intend to refinance within a few years. ARMs can be advantageous for those who anticipate their property's value to increase and those who plan to sell their homes quickly because an adjustable-rate mortgage can help reduce monthly mortgage payments.

mortgage: What You Need to Know About Balloon Mortgage - 07/01/22 08:38 PM
A balloon mortgage is a short-term home loan with low payments at the beginning and is paid off with a large amount (balloon payment) at the end of the term during the loan. The lender will use an amortization plan to calculate the borrower's balloon payment. Many people who choose balloon mortgages try to refinance their loans or sell their houses before the loan term is over since balloon payments are often higher than many people can afford.

mortgage: What You Need to Know About Fixed Mortgage - 07/01/22 08:38 PM
A fixed-rate mortgage has a rate of interest that stays the same throughout the loan and generally has a term of 15 or 30 years. This means that unless you refinance your loan or taxes and insurance prices change, your monthly mortgage payments will not adjust during the loan's lifetime. The higher your credit score, the more likely you will be approved for the fixed-rate mortgage you want.

mortgage: What You Need to Know About Interest-only Mortgage - 07/01/22 08:38 PM
An interest-only mortgage or IO mortgage allows borrowers to make interest payments only for an initial period. After that period, the borrower can pay the balance in full or start the monthly payments.
An interest-only mortgage is appealing because the initial payment is lower. You can keep making only interest payments for up to ten years before you must start paying down the principal. But you'll pay more overall interest, and since interest-only loans aren't qualified mortgages, you may have to meet stricter requirements to qualify.

mortgage: VA Loan - 06/27/22 01:38 AM
VA Loan
 
The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) guarantees mortgages made by private lenders to qualified borrowers who do not have to put down any money upfront. Borrowers eligible for a VA loan can use the funds for either a first home purchase or refinance an existing mortgage. Homeownership can be a significant financial commitment, but VA Loans can help veterans, active-duty service members, and others get a good deal by reducing the amount they have to put down.

mortgage: Adjustable-Rate Mortgage - 06/27/22 01:38 AM
One type of mortgage loan with a changing interest rate is called an adjustable-rate mortgage (ARM). This type of loan goes by a few names: variable rate mortgage and floating rate mortgage. It is a type of mortgage in which the interest rate may change regularly depending on the performance of a specific benchmark index. This means that your regular payment amount could go up or down. Remember that most adjustable-rate mortgages (ARMs) limit how much the interest rate or payments can go up each year or over the loan period.
